Abstract

In a serial communication system having a device including a receiver detection module, this specification is directed to systems and methods for selectively reducing the power consumed by the receiver detection module, preferably when the device is operating in a low power mode. In some embodiments, a signal detection module is configured to receive a control signal from the transmitter of a device at the other end of the communications link to control the operation of the receiver detection module. The control signal may be in-band or may be transmitted on a sideband of the serial link.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A communication system comprising:
 a transmitter;   a receiver including a receiver detection module and a power module; and   a serial link between the transmitter and the receiver,   a signal detection module configured to sense a control signal carried on the serial link and operatively coupled to the power module,   wherein the receiver detection module is configured to be operable during a power save state of the serial link to determine an operational condition of the serial link and wherein the power module is configured to selectively operate the receiver detection module in a low power mode during the power save state of the serial link on the basis of the control signal.   
     
     
         2 . The communications system of  claim 1 , wherein the low power mode of the receiver detection module is a duty cycle mode. 
     
     
         3 - 4 . (canceled) 
     
     
         5 . The communication system of  claim 1 , wherein the signal detection module is configured to detect a common mode signal carried on the serial link. 
     
     
         6 . The communication system of  claim 1 , wherein the signal detection module is configured to detect a differential mode signal carried on the serial link. 
     
     
         7 . The communication system of  claim 1 , wherein the serial link comprises a PCIe link. 
     
     
         8 . The communication system of  claim 1 , wherein the receiver detection module comprises electric idle detection logic. 
     
     
         9 . The communication system of  claim 8 , wherein the power module is configured to disable the electric idle detection logic to selectively operate the receiver detection module in the low power mode. 
     
     
         10 . A serial communication system comprising a host having a transmitter and a client having a receiver, wherein the transmitter and the receiver are configured to communicate through transfer of differential data signals over a link using a protocol that specifies at least one active state and at least one power save state and the host is configured to transmit a control signal in-band, a receiver detection module in the client configured be operable during the power save state to determine an operational state of the link, a signal detection module in the client configured to sense the control signal and a power module in the client configured to selectively operate the receiver detection module in low power mode on the basis of the control signal from the host. 
     
     
         11 . The serial communication system of  claim 10 , wherein the receiver detection module comprises electric idle detection logic and wherein the low power mode of the receiver detection module disables the electric idle detection logic. 
     
     
         12 . The serial communication system of  claim 11  wherein the serial communication system is a PCIe system and wherein the active state of the serial communication system is a L0 link state and the power save state of the serial communication system is a L1 link state. 
     
     
         13 - 14 . (canceled) 
     
     
         15 . The serial communication system of  claim 10 , wherein the control signal comprises an in-band common mode signal. 
     
     
         16 . The serial communication system of  claim 10 , wherein the control signal comprises an in-band differential mode signal. 
     
     
         17 . The serial communication system of  claim 10 , wherein the power module selectively operate the receiver detection module in low power mode by operating the receiver detection module in a duty cycle mode. 
     
     
         18 . A method for standby power reduction in a serial communication system having a transmitter and receiver, communicating over a serial data link, comprising
 operating the serial data link in a power save state;   sending an in-band control signal with the transmitter;   detecting the control signal in-band on the serial data link; and   selectively operating a receiver detection module of the receiver configured to determine an operational condition of the serial data link in a low power mode while the serial data link is in the power save state on the basis of the control signal.   
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the serial data link comprises a PCIe link, wherein the power save state of the serial data link is an L1 state, and wherein the low power mode comprises disabling electrical idle detection logic in the receiver detection module. 
     
     
         20 - 22 . (canceled) 
     
     
         23 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ein detecting the control signal comprises detecting a common mode signal on the serial data link. 
     
     
         24 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ein detecting the control signal comprises detecting a differential mode signal on the serial data link.
